如何为引擎组件注册 Notification Services 实例 (SQL Server Management Studio)

在应用程序定义中,指定运行每个宿主事件提供程序、生成器和分发服务器的服务器。在其中的每个服务器上,需要运行 Notification Services 引擎。通常,Notification Services 引擎由 NS$instanceName Microsoft Windows 服务运行,该服务是在注册 Notification Services 实例时创建的。本主题说明了如何注册 Notification Services 实例和创建 Windows 服务。

ms171077.note(zh-cn,SQL.90).gif注意:
使用 Microsoft SQL Server Management Studio 注册 Notification Services 实例时,将在本地服务器上创建注册表项(在数据库服务器上则不一定)。注册表项中的数据库服务器值就是在 SQL Server Management Studio 中连接的数据库引擎 实例。
ms171077.note(zh-cn,SQL.90).gif注意:
如果在自定义应用程序中承载 Notification Services 引擎,则在注册实例时不创建 Windows 服务。有关详细信息,请参阅宿主 Notification Services 引擎

注册 Notification Services 实例和创建 Windows 服务

  1. 在 SQL Server Management Studio 中,请确保连接到承载实例和应用程序数据库的数据库引擎 实例。

  2. 在对象资源管理器中,展开 Notification Services 节点。

  3. 右键单击要注册的实例,指向**“任务”,然后选择“注册”**。

  4. 选择**“创建 Windows 服务”**复选框。

  5. 输入 Windows 服务的登录帐户和密码。此帐户必须是本地 Windows 帐户、域 Windows 帐户或内置 Windows 帐户,该帐户是本地计算机上用户组的成员。有关详细信息,请参阅配置 Notification Services 的 Windows 帐户

  6. 如果使用 SQL Server 身份验证来访问数据库,则选择**“SQL Server 身份验证”并输入有效的 SQL Server 登录名和密码。否则,保留“Windows 身份验证”**的选中状态。

  7. 如果使用参数加密,请在左窗格中选择**“加密”**,然后输入创建实例时使用的加密密钥。

  8. 单击**“确定”**注册实例,创建性能计数器,然后创建 Windows 服务。

请参阅

概念

更新注册表信息

其他资源

部署 Notification Services
nscontrol register 命令
注册实例(常规)
管理实例和应用程序帮助主题 (Notification Services)

帮助和信息

获取 SQL Server 2005 帮助